WordPress wp_targeted_link_rel 的 SEO 安全过滤实现:深度解析 各位同学,大家好!今天我们来深入探讨 WordPress 中一个重要的安全过滤函数:wp_targeted_link_rel。这个函数专门用于处理链接的 rel 属性,在保证 SEO 友好的同时,防止潜在的安全漏洞。我们将从背景知识、函数实现、安全考虑和最佳实践等方面进行详细分析。 1. 背景知识:rel 属性与 SEO 安全 rel 属性是 HTML <a> 标签的一个重要属性,用于指定当前文档与链接目标文档之间的关系。常见的 rel 属性值包括: noopener: 阻止新标签页访问 opener window,防止恶意网站通过 window.opener 修改原页面。 noreferrer: 阻止浏览器在 HTTP 请求头中发送 Referer 信息,保护用户隐私。 nofollow: 告诉搜索引擎不要跟踪该链接,用于控制链接权重,避免传递 PageRank 给不信任的网站。 ugc: 用于标记用户生成的内容(User Generated Content)中的链接,如评论 …